News:The Union Cabinet has approved an MoU between India and the Republic of Cote d’Ivoire on Cooperation in the field of Health.

Facts:

About Côte d’Ivoire:

  • Côte d’Ivoire or Ivory Coast is located on the south coast of West Africa.
  • It’s political capital is Yamoussoukro while its economic capital and largest city is the port city of Abidjan.The official language of the republic is French.
  • It borders Guinea and Liberia to the west, Burkina Faso and Mali to the north, Ghana to the east and the Gulf of Guinea (Atlantic Ocean) to the south.

India and Côte d’Ivoire Relations:

  • India and Côte d’Ivoire have traditionally enjoyed cordial and friendly relations.
  • India established its Embassy in Abidjan in 1979 while Côte d’Ivoire opened its Resident Mission in New Delhi in September 2004.
  • India is also facilitating the development of an IT-cum-Technology Park in Abidjan, named after Mahatma Gandhi.

About Techno-Economic Approach for Africa–India Movement(TEAM–9):

  • India launched the TEAM-9 initiative in 2004 with eight energy- and resource-rich West African countries including Ivory Coast, Senegal, Mali, Guinea-Bissau, Ghana, and Burkina Faso.
  • It aims to engage the underdeveloped yet resource-wealthy countries of West Africa which require both low-cost technology and investment to develop their infrastructure.
